Transaction eda8942e66837e3e82efd187ae17e98f455127c0a14561272289159cd2656a5e
1 Input
1 Output
-
eda8942e66837e3e82efd187ae17e98f455127c0a14561272289159cd2656a5e:0
- value
- 550263
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f2324d374f4b82493c75d65eb03a6bd11a914c
- address
- bc1quherynfhfa9cyjfuwht9avp6d0g34y2v28h4ku